The fourth annual Duff & Phelps IP Value Summit will take place October 16-17, 2017 at The Ritz-Carlton in Half Moon Bay, California.

Duff & Phelps cordially invites you to the 4th Annual IP Value Summit, taking place October 16-17 at the Ritz-Carlton in Half Moon Bay, CA. Duff & Phelps developed this conference four years ago with the goal of providing our Intellectual Property industry colleagues and peers with a forum to discuss current events, best practices, and the challenges and opportunities in valuing, managing, monetizing and protecting intellectual property assets in a rapidly-evolving regulatory environment.  Join us as we bring together corporate executives, attorneys, investors and other experts to discuss intellectual property best practices, case studies, challenges and opportunities.

We are pleased to announce that David Simon, Senior Vice President, Intellectual Property at Salesforce will be delivering this year’s keynote. Additionally, Boris Teksler, CEO of Conversant Intellectual Property Management, Inc., and former head of Apple Inc.’s Patent Licensing & Strategy and co-founder of the Intellectual Property Licensing Business at Hewlett-Packard Company, will be presenting our closing keynote address.  We also have confirmed speakers and IP experts from Netflix, Airbnb, Accenture, Visa Inc., Kirkland & Ellis LLP, Altaba, Kilpatrick, Townsend and Stockton LLP, Foley Hoag LLP, Unicom Global, IBM among others.

 

Our general session panel discussion will be around IP Strategy: Risks and Rewards Across the Intellectual Property Life Cycle. Our panel will discuss global IP strategy issues from a University, Industry, Tax and Legal perspective.  The panel will share their views on current and future issues impacting strategy at various stages of the IP life cycle including:

  • Innovation
  • Technology Transfer
  • Commercialization
  • Licensing and Collaboration
  • Protection and Enforcement
  • Global Litigation Landscape
  • Taxation
